Transaction 42a88850ed92eb43c05a5a0d6fb5e5686da351b8c24243fcc9b05c7752469aeb
1 Input
1 Output
-
42a88850ed92eb43c05a5a0d6fb5e5686da351b8c24243fcc9b05c7752469aeb:0
- value
- 708920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ea64440c34c461b3cc2afb91193fbe631af4e6c OP_EQUAL
- address
- 37QGzqueRbJeWgM2Jcnw6yitNHzRQemgsm